Log4j 1.2 vulnerabilities
3 known CVE vulnerabilities in Log4j 1.2, translated and rated.
- CVE-2022-23302High
JMSSink in all versions of Log4j 1.x is vulnerable to deserialization of untrusted data when the attacker has write access to the Log4j configuration or if the configuration references an LDAP service the attacker has access to. This can lead to remote code execution.
- CVE-2021-4104High
JMSAppender in Log4j 1.2 is vulnerable to deserialization of untrusted data when the attacker has write access to the Log4j configuration. This can lead to remote code execution through unauthorized JNDI requests.
- CVE-2022-23305Critical
The JDBCAppender in Log4j 1.2.x accepts SQL statements as a configuration parameter, allowing attackers to manipulate SQL by entering crafted strings into input fields or headers of an application. This can lead to unintended SQL queries being executed.
